Sagittarius Venus – Love & Compatibility

venus-in-sagittarius-couple

1. They need someone who can keep up with their adventurous spirit

Sagittarius Venus individuals are known for their love of adventure and exploration.

They need a partner who can keep up with their free-spirited nature and go along with their impulsive decisions.

Signs that share this energy include Aries, Aquarius, and fellow Sagittarians.

2. Communication is key

Venus in Sagittarius individuals are big talkers and need someone who can keep up with their witty banter and philosophical musings.

Signs that share this intellectual connection include Gemini, Libra, and other Sagittarians.

3. Freedom is a must

The last thing a Venus in Sagittarius individual wants is to feel tied down or restricted in a relationship.

They need a partner who understands their need for independence and allows them the space to pursue their passions and interests.

Signs that share this sense of freedom include Aquarius, Pisces, and fellow Sagittarians.

4. Spontaneity is the spice of life

Venus in Sagittarius individuals thrive on spontaneity and unpredictability in their relationships.

They need a partner who can keep things exciting and embrace their wild side.

Signs that share this sense of adventure include Aries, Leo, and other Sagittarians.

5. Honesty is the best policy

Sagittarius Venus individuals value honesty and authenticity above all else in a relationship.

They need a partner who can match their straightforward and blunt communication style and isn’t afraid to speak their mind.

Signs that share this sense of transparency include Leo, Sagittarius, and Aquarius.
